DEXTROCHE'RIUM. A bracelet worn round the wrist of the right arm, as in the annexed example (Dextrocherium/1.1), supposed to represent the portrait of a Pompeian lady, from a painting in that city. Capitolin. Maxim. 6. Id. Maxim. Jun. 1.
